early 1930's
Arch Kraft 15"
Archtop Acoustic
rare early blues/jazz archtop guitar
professional quality
old bright, sassy sound - percussive
& woody - great for recording
probably made by Kay (possibly Gretsch
because of the sunburst sides)
unique long, 26" scale, neck
unique slotted headstock (for an archtop)
beautiful sunburst finish on top & sides
pressed spruce top; round sound-hole with
multi-striped purfling; 3-1/2" deep body
maple back, sides, neck & headstock
ebony fretboard with "dot" inlays
white & black cellulose plastic shield,
with"ARCH KRAFT" logo, affixed to
headstock
creme & black 3-ply binding on top; single-ply
on back, no binding on
headstock or fretboard
no pickguard
adjustable Brazilian rosewood bridge
trapeze tailpiece
open strip tuners
